Sun 19 May 2013 09:44:34 PM UTC, original submission:  

I think maybe reseq isn't counting the time it takes to write things, as delay times. It should count starting from the moment it begins writing things out, and then only delay for whatever amount of time is left.

Teseq should have an adjustable threshold for how small a delay it's willing to emit a delay line for (say, 50ms?), and should adjust its number of significant digits accordingly. Definitely don't emit 0.000000, as I'm sometimes seeing.
